After playing a couple of practice games with slightly lesser results, this one was played very effectively and resulted in an early 980 ad conquest.

Goals:
Fastest journey to Steam engine combined also with arriving there with enough funds to finance a very fast conquest of the 5 foreign civs. Planned wonders and likely sequence: Marcos, Lighthouse, Colossus, Shakespeare's.... and most likely Magellan's if finances permit. Recurring undemanded Hide availability factors in very heavily and i will seek to trade where the bonuses are maximized. This would normally be Kyoto which provides almost the same "trade bonus distance" as Carthage but with a significantly quicker boat trip utilizing the diagonal squares, but Kyoto has chosen to stay in despotism throughout most of the game, so this led me to Carthage. I plan for 1 early demanded gold trade and getting 2 additional trades en route, then an early size 12 with these trades en route before sending a 2nd trireme with 2 additional trades into the water.

Note that this game was played on the multiplayer gold version. I only mention it to help explain the much employed tactic in dealing with the almost always hostile foreign civs by making war with them the turn they complete a tech i want, before being able to enjoy a one-turn window of opportunity in the following turn to trade tech with them in cease fire or peace.

Level is deity.

Building up a strike force consists of 10+ spies for poisoning and destroying fortresses, a horseman, a few ironclads and a chain of transports, as many as communism could support. Building Factory and Magellan. Setting tax rate to 8/0/2, for most gold possible and just enough luxury for celebrating. Later spamming spies and replacing damaged ironclads with transports to pick up recuperated spies.

There wasn't as much gold as OCC on normal random map because everyone had one city and rating was fluctuating a lot. Instead of careful tech guiding I had to tech bomb everyone to keep their ratings over my head. Or maybe I should have established a good stream of hides vans instead?
